Abortion Pill Maker Appeals To Supreme Court To Preserve Access After Lower Court Restrictions

  • The manufacturer of the abortion pill mifepristone has asked the Supreme Court to review restrictions imposed by a lower court ruling.
  • The restrictions include barring telemedicine prescriptions and mail delivery of mifepristone.
  • The Biden administration has also appealed to defend the existing federal approval of mifepristone, deemed safe and effective by medical organizations.
  • The Supreme Court's decision, expected by early summer 2024, will determine nationwide access to medication abortion.
  • This is the most high-profile abortion case since Roe v. Wade was overturned, carrying implications for reproductive rights.
